The 1997 Acid Rain Assessment pointed to the urgent need for further sulphur dioxide reductions. It also showed a growing need to address the role of nitrogen oxides and the extent of ecosystem sensitivity to acidification. Stronger evidence pointed to possible forest and ecosystem damage at lower levels of pollution.

Acidic fog can be more hazardous to health than acid rain as small droplets can be inhaled. These atmospheric acids can cause respiratory problems in humans such as throat, nose, and eye irritation, headache, and asthma. Acid fog is particularly dangerous for the elderly, those who are ill, and people who have chronic respiratory conditions.

Does Gypsum fizz in acid? Characteristics: Rock gypsum is composed mainly of the single mineral, gypsum. Gypsum is very soft (softer than a fingernail and so can be scratched by a fingernail). It's color is typically clear or white, but can take on color from impurities, such as pink or yellow. It will not effervesce (fizz) in dilute HCl acid.

Since limestone is mostly calcium carbonate, it is damaged by acid rain. Sodium carbonate, magnesium carbonate, zinc carbonate and copper carbonate also react with acids - they fizz when in contact with acids, and the carbon dioxide released can be detected using limewater .

What is the function of deaerator? Deaerators are mechanical devices that remove dissolved gases from boiler feedwater.Deaeration protects the steam system from the effects of corrosive gases. It accomplishes this by reducing the concentration of dissolved oxygen and carbon dioxide to a level where corrosion is minimized.

Limestone quarries have higher pH levels due to the carbonate materials in the stone. Lightning can lower the pH of rain. As mentioned earlier, unpolluted rain is slightly acidic (pH of 5.6). The pH of rain can also be lowered due to volcanic ash, sulfate-reducing bacteria in wetlands, airborne particulates from wildfires and even lightning ⁹.

Acidic rain and fog in western US metropolitan areas such as L.A. is mostly caused by HNO3 (nitric acid), due to all of the automobile exhaust. Acid rain in the north east is mostly H2SO4 (sulfuric acid) from all of the coal buring that goes on there. In Hawaii, Kilauea volcano puts sulfur into the atmosphere and makes natural acid rain.
